A leading recruitment agency is seeking a Sales Support Specialist to join a global furniture manufacturer based in Farringdon. This hybrid role involves managing B2B customer orders, handling inquiries, and coordinating with internal teams to ensure excellent service.
Candidates must have:
- Over 5 years' experience in sales support
- Expertise in post-Brexit export processes
- A degree or similar qualifications
Competitive benefits, including annual leave and pension contributions, are provided.
